Located on Esplanade Avenue and named in honor of Mother Cabrini who was a nun here, this school suffered water damage after Hurricane Katrina. However, with a dedicated staff who worked tirelessly the past 8 weeks, Cabrini will reopen on November 8 not only for its own girl students but for the boys of Holy Cross School as well. At present they share a school in Baton Rouge from 4 to 9 p.m. Beginning November 8 the girls will attend until 2 and the boys will begin at 3 p.m.
I believe they have enjoyed their co-ed school in Baton Rouge but I do not think they will miss their 120 miles roundtrip commute everyday.
Holy Cross hopes to have its campus ready with mobile classrooms by January 2, 2006.
This will be the second and third Catholic high school to re-open in New Orleans. There are no public schools open.
